DSWorld: AI World Model for Efficient Data Science Agents
Summary
DSWorld introduces a Data Science World Model to enable autonomous data science agents to anticipate operation effects, reducing reliance on expensive trial-and-error. It combines structured state construction, cost-aware routing, and an LLM-based simulator, accelerating agent training and inference while maintaining performance.

Key takeaways
- Autonomous data science agents are often bottlenecked by expensive trial-and-error.
- DSWorld introduces a Data Science World Model to predict operation effects.
- It accelerates RL-based agent training by 14x and inference by 3-6x.
- The framework combines structured states, cost-aware routing, and an LLM simulator.
